National Guard Coping With Recruiting Concerns

June 22, 2005 By admin Leave a Comment

The Missouri National Guard says the high number of deployments could be costing it in the recruitment arena. The Guard’s Major John Findley says recruitment numbers are at only about half of what was set as a goal and there are only three months left in the counting period. Findley says those numbers were even helped by an uptick in recruiting back people who had gotten out because of previous multiple deployments. Findley admits the rollercoaster of people in and out of the Guard plays havoc on trying to manage the force.
